Fiberglass reinforced plastic tanks are often utilized for extra protection. One reason is other types of tanks, particularly polyethylene tanks, are limited in capacity. The polyethylene tanks are limited to approximately 75,000 liters. While many cite steel tank storage as a better option, fiberglass reinforced tanks are far more cost effective and have a much greater chemical resistance than steel tanks.
With impressive hoop strength, fire water tanks can withstand any conditions, including harsh weather in northern climates. Treated with an anti-corrosion liner and multiple layers of fiberglass, these tanks are meant to last with a longer service life than other plastic containers.
